当前位置:软件学堂 > 资讯首页 > 软件教程 > 办公软件 > 二级缓存是什么意思?二级缓存和三级缓存的区别

二级缓存是什么意思?二级缓存和三级缓存的区别

2013/2/23 20:52:44作者:佚名来源:网络

移动端

前面小编给大家介绍了电脑的缓存文件是什么的相关内容。建议你有兴趣的话去看看了解电脑缓存文件的相关内容。说到缓存文件其中包括二级缓存和三级缓存。那么二级缓存是什么意思?其中二级缓存和三级缓存有哪些区别呢?那么这里小编就针对以上疑问给大家作详细讲解。

先来了解教电脑缓存的工作原理?

电脑缓存是当cpu在读取数据的时候,先是从缓存文件中查找,然后找到之后会自动读取在输入到cpu进行处理,当然如果没有在缓存中找到对应的缓存文件的话,那么就会从内存中读取并且传输给cpu来处理。当然这样的话需要一定的时间所以会很慢。等cpu处理之后,就很贵把这个暑假所在的数据块保存在缓存文件中,这样的话在以后读取这项数据的时候就直接在缓存中进行,这样就不要重复在内存中调用并读取数据了。

二级缓存和三级缓存有哪些区别

了解了电脑缓存的作用,对于电脑缓存又分为一级、二级、三级缓存。那么小编就对缓存来逐一介绍吧。

一级缓存都内置在CPU内部并与CPU同速运行,可以有效的提高CPU的运行效率。一级缓存越大,CPU的运行效率越高,但受到CPU内部结构的限制,一级缓存的容量都很小。

所谓二级缓存,它是为了协调一级缓存和内存之间的速度。cpu调用缓存首先是一级缓存,不够当处理器的速度逐渐提升了,导致一级缓存就供应不了需求了,这样就提升到二级缓存了。二级缓存它是比一级缓存的速度相对来说会慢,但是它比一级缓存的空间容量要大。主要就是做一级缓存和内存之间数据临时交换的地方用。

三级缓存的话也是一样的。是为读取二级缓存后未命中的数据设计的—种缓存,在拥有三级缓存的CPU中,只有约5%的数据需要从内存中调用,这大大提高了CPU的效率。

现在我们来分析下现在主流的cpu处理器的缓存作用,如果你使用的AMD型号的cpu处理器的话一般只有一二级缓存,是没有三级缓存的。如果是intel处理器的话,通常情况是只有二三级缓存。但是intel高端的处理器的话是只有一级和三级缓存。那么这些为大家作为了解。

以上就是二级缓存是什么意思的全部内容了,当然小编也介绍了二级缓存和三级缓存有哪些区别。相信大家都对此有所了解了吧。希望对你有所帮助。更多教程请继续浏览学无忧。

标签: 缓存